Latest publication from a fun collaboration with Brian Long and Bert Chandler... polyethylene segregation within porous supports is molar mass dependent. We are now looking at pore size engineering to control product distribution from catalytic deconstruction of plastic waste
doi.org/10.1021/acs....
Molar-Mass-Dependent Partitioning of Polyethylene in Nanopores of Model Catalyst Supports from Small-Angle Neutron Scattering
Heterogeneous catalysis offers opportunities to enhance valorization of plastic waste via chemical recycling through control of the upcycled product distributions. Minimizing low-value light hydrocarb...
